Student Objectives for Laboratory 10

Understand what a representative sample is
Understand the importance of sample size in obtaining a representative sample

Understand what it means for a population to have random mating
Know that random mating produces a binomial distribution of genotypes
Understand what it means for a population to be in Hardy-Weinberg Equilibrium
Know the conditions that must exist for a population to be in HWE
Know how to calculate genotype and allele frequencies for a population in HWE

Understand how genetic drift occurs in populations
Understand how alleles can go extinct under genetic drift

Understand how selection occurs in populations
Be able to define fitness
Be able to predict the fate of alleles given fitness values of genotypes
Know how deleterious recessive alleles persist in populations.
